URL: https://www.opennet.me/cgi-bin/openforum/vsluhboard.cgi
Форум: vsluhforumID3
Нить номер: 119969
[ Назад ]

Исходное сообщение
"Раздел полезных советов: Конвертация Chrome-дополнения для з..."

Отправлено auto_tips , 05-Мрт-20 10:58 
Для установки в Firefox браузерных дополнений на базе API WebExtension, подготовленных только для Chrome или Opera, можно использовать дополнение  Foxified (https://github.com/Noitidart/Chrome-Store-Foxified). Проблема в том, что Foxified не может быть запущен, начиная с Firefox 57, в котором была прекращена поддержка XUL/XPCOM.

В качестве обходного пути предлагается параллельно с основной актуальной версией Firefox установить Firefox 56 и запустить в нём [[https://github.com/Noitidart/Chrome-Store-Foxified/releases Foxified]].  

Перед началом работы следует зарегистрироваться в каталоге дополнений Mozilla  AMO (https://addons.mozilla.org) или войти в существующую учётную запись для последующего формирования цифровой подписи.

Далее нужно скопировать URL Chrome-дополнения из Chrome WebStore и добавить его через меню "add to firefox, available on chrome" в Foxified. После этого во вкладке "chrome store foxified" нужно принять соглашение  Mozilla AMO. После завершения преобразования в верхнем правом углу появится кнопка "add" с предложением установить дополнение.

После этого переходим на страницу about:debugging  и активируем режим отладки дополнений ("enable add-on debugging"). Находим в списке дополнений преобразованное дополнение и определяем его идентификатор
(Extension ID), заданный в форме "*@chrome-store-foxified-*".

Закрываем Firefox 56 и находим в каталоге с дополнениями Firefox (/.mozilla/firefox/*/extensions) xpi-файл с найденным идентификатором.
Запускаем актуальный Firefox и устанавливаем полученный xpi-файл через кнопку с шестерёнкой в менеджере дополнений (about:addons), выбрав в меню "Install Add-on from File".

URL: https://github.com/Noitidart/Chrome-Store-Foxified/issues/12...
Обсуждается: http://www.opennet.me/tips/info/3138.shtml


Содержание

Сообщения в этом обсуждении
"Конвертация Chrome-дополнения для запуска в Firefox"
Отправлено Аноним , 05-Мрт-20 10:58 
> В качестве обходного пути предлагается параллельно с основной актуальной

версией Firefox установить Firefox 56 и запустить в нём Foxified.

Какой-то цирк.


"Конвертация Chrome-дополнения для запуска в Firefox"
Отправлено Аноним , 05-Мрт-20 18:38 
пожалуй я не знаю настолько нужных дополнений

"Конвертация Chrome-дополнения для запуска в Firefox"
Отправлено О , 09-Мрт-20 06:59 
То есть нужно спалить неподдерживаемому расширению учетку мозиллы и потом на время о нем забыть?

"Конвертация Chrome-дополнения для запуска в Firefox"
Отправлено X86 , 28-Мрт-20 08:37 
Расширению надо спалить учетку для этого расширения

"Конвертация Chrome-дополнения для запуска в Firefox"
Отправлено mandms , 28-Мрт-20 18:03 
Делал плагин для Firefox 57+, Кто пробовал кто скажет насколько легко Firefox плагин перенести в Chrome?

"Конвертация Chrome-дополнения для запуска в Firefox"
Отправлено Аноним , 13-Май-20 01:28 
Для хромого можно воспользоваться полифиллом для Web Extension API, только на днях собирал расширение, полёт нормальный

https://github.com/mozilla/webextension-polyfill